Step 3: Install the Application
For Windows:
- Locate the downloaded
.exe file in your Downloads folder.
- Double-click the file to begin installation.
- Follow the on-screen instructions to complete the installation.
- After installation, you can find ralph-mcp in your Start menu.
For macOS:
- Find the downloaded
.dmg file in your Downloads folder.
- Double-click the file to open it.
- Drag the ralph-mcp icon into your Applications folder.
- You can now launch ralph-mcp from your Applications.
For Linux:
- Open your terminal.
- Use the command below to extract the downloaded tarball.
tar -xzf ralph-mcp-latest.tar.gz
- Navigate to the extracted folder.

Step 4: Quality Gates
ralph-mcp automatically implements quality checks. This ensures that your projects meet specific standards before merging changes. Keep an eye on the notifications to make necessary adjustments.
